Security Comparison



When thinking about LASIK versus PRK, one of the crucial aspects to examine is the security of each procedure. LASIK, a popular refractive surgical procedure, includes creating a flap in the cornea to reshape it making use of a laser. While LASIK is normally thought about secure, there are prospective threats such as completely dry eyes, halos, and glow.

On the other hand, PRK, a comparable procedure, gets rid of the demand for a corneal flap and instead reshapes the cornea's surface area directly. Recuperation Time Distinctions



Opting for either LASIK or PRK involves taking into consideration the recovery time differences post-surgery. After going through LASIK, most people experience a relatively quick recovery, with many being able to go back to regular activities within a day or more. The majority of patients notice boosted vision virtually instantly after the procedure, with optimum outcomes commonly accomplished within a few days to a week.

On the other hand, PRK normally needs a much longer recuperation period contrasted to LASIK. Complying with PRK, it's common for individuals to experience blurry vision and discomfort for a couple of days or even approximately a week. Complete visual recuperation after PRK might take a number of weeks to months, as the surface area of the cornea requires time to heal entirely.

Potential Results Analysis



Considering the potential outcomes is an important aspect when determining between LASIK and PRK. LASIK normally uses quicker aesthetic recuperation and much less pain post-surgery contrasted to PRK. Nevertheless, PRK might be a better choice for people with slim corneas or specific corneal irregularities. It's necessary to recognize that while LASIK gives fast improvement in vision within a couple of hours, PRK might need a longer time for visual recuperation, often up to a couple of weeks. Both procedures have high success rates, with many patients attaining 20/20 vision or better.




Possible results also consist of the danger of issues. LASIK has a reduced risk of corneal haze and scarring yet carries a slightly greater risk of flap-related problems.
